Verbal bridges use language—repetition of keywords and synonyms, use of transitions, &c.—that makes the logical connections between your ideas clear to your reader. Structural Components Topic sentence – The first sentence in a paragraph should clearly announce the main claim that will be supported by the content of the paragraph.
